After the Consumer report magazine published the message "Pesticide spraying on Organic vegetables" in December 1987, it caused a lot of reaction, and the foundation often received phone calls for inquiries. Although this incident has come to an end for the time being, there is no final conclusion as to how the details and the truth still look like a fog.

This time, organic vegetables were detected by the consumer foundation to contain dithiocarbamate, Taosong, prednisone and other pesticides. Among them, a person who is about to be recognized by the Foundation for ​​ implementation has tested hollow cabbage and pakchoi, in which pakchoi was found to contain 0.31 ppm dithiocarbamates. After the disclosure of this incident, both the farmer and this association were shocked. According to the information of this Council and the Liugong Foundation, it is believed that this phenomenon should not have occurred when they have been in contact with the farmer over the past two years or so. Therefore, the foundation inspector and the farmer began to investigate the crux of the problem.

Coincidentally, just before the incident, the Foundation held two training courses on plant protection of organic crops at the Agricultural push Center of Chung Hing University, from which we learned the message that certain thurias were adulterated with pesticides. Our examiners were curious for a moment. It was tested at random and confirmed to be true. Therefore, this Council went back to inquire about the situation of the farmer's use of Thali, and initially concluded that the crux of the problem may lie in the high content of Thali. During this period, the farmer also invited personnel from the Consumer Foundation, the agricultural improvement farm, and agricultural administrative organs to go to the scene to understand the facts and samples, and most people held positive views on the operation of the farm.

The staff of the Consumer Foundation are in order to confirm whether there is a problem with Suri? Two times, Suri was sent to a pesticide inspection unit for testing, and it was found that it did contain dithiocarbamates (a.0.8 ppm, b.0.7 ppm) and Jiabaofu (a.2ppm dint bl 7 ppm). For the sake of caution, we also sent the purchase of Suri from the same brand to a certain testing unit for testing, but the result was very different from that of the Consumer Foundation. So far, it is still a fog, and no conclusion has been reached.
